It is crucial to understand that energy drinks do not provide genuine energy to the body. Rather than acting as a fuel source, they function as stimulants, artificially accelerating various bodily processes. This stimulation, however, often comes at a cost—the body’s internal energy reserves are depleted, much like taking out a loan that must be repaid later. After the temporary rush subsides, consumers frequently experience fatigue, insomnia, heightened nervousness, or even depressive symptoms. Essentially, although these drinks provide a fleeting surge in alertness, they offer no lasting benefits to overall vitality or well-being.
The Impact of Key Ingredients in Energy Drinks
The main ingredients in energy drinks significantly determine their physiological effects and potential risks. One prominent component is carbohydrates, mainly in the form of sugars, which rapidly satisfy short-term energy demands. However, excessive sugar intake can cause blood sugar level fluctuations, leading to adverse effects such as energy crashes and metabolic strain.
The most well-known ingredient is caffeine, a potent central nervous system stimulant present in all energy drinks. In moderate doses—typically around 100 mg—caffeine enhances cognitive functions like attention and alertness temporarily. Yet, intakes exceeding approximately 238 mg can negatively affect cardiovascular health, leading to risks such as arrhythmias and elevated blood pressure. Thus, while caffeine can be beneficial in controlled amounts, overconsumption remains dangerous.
Another common additive is taurine, an amino acid found in muscle tissue and traditionally believed to support heart and brain function. Despite its inclusion in many formulations, recent scientific debates question whether taurine actually exerts meaningful biological effects in humans, leaving its actual benefits uncertain.
Carnitine, a natural compound found within human cells, is also frequently added to energy drinks. It plays a role in fatty acid metabolism and is thought to accelerate metabolic rates. Additionally, carnitine may reduce muscle fatigue and aid those engaging in intense physical activity, suggesting some supporting physiological functions, though these effects may vary individually.
Herbal stimulants such as guarana and ginseng are sometimes incorporated for their energizing properties. Guarana, traditionally used in medicine for reducing lactic acid buildup post-exercise and vascular health support, and ginseng, reputed for promoting vitality, have yet to be conclusively validated by robust scientific evidence regarding their energizing effects within energy drinks.
